Perpetrator : kills because they think real or perceived dishonor has been brought to their name.
Victim : dies because they are believed to have brought dishonor based on something they said/did, or the mere suspicion of the same.
The girl fits neither role.
It appears so. Which actually suggests she stopped her parents from honor-killing her. She didn’t kill them because they were behaving dishonorably or brought shame to her. (While they might’ve killed her because* she’d* bring shame to them). Honor isn’t a motive in this story. Had she not killed her parents, it potentially could have been.
